History of animal welfare laws starts in the 19th century :- Often these laws were against doing the act in public! Later, animals were legally protected for their own sake. Increasing world trade and emergence of free trade areas have a considerable impact on animals. Welfare standards which impose restrictions and impair competitiveness will be more readily accepted if they must be equally observed by all competitors. There is a need for international harmonization and this is gradually beginning to happen. E. g. in the eu treaty (maastricht conference, 1991) it is stated that member states should. pay full regard to the welfare requirements of animals.
